Inspiration
The difficulties surrounding making friends at uni.
What it does
Our app aims to allow students to meet other students and solve a variety of challenges commonly faced in educational environments. It would help reduce social isolation by making it easier for students to connect with peers who share similar interests, courses, or backgrounds. The app could also facilitate the formation of study groups, making academic collaboration more accessible and efficient. Additionally, it could serve as a platform for networking, helping students build relationships that support both their academic and professional goals.
How we built it
Backend: Supabase, Springboot Frontend: Next.JS
Challenges we ran into
Getting the register page to upload the images to the storage bucket on Supabase Normalising the database instead of keeping all the records in one big table
Accomplishments that we're proud of
Developing a fully functional chat feature that allows P2P live chatting. Implementing a min heap data structure to sort through potential matches and show the user the most compatible match based on a similarity score.
What we learned
Version control, multiple people working on the same features
What's next for ilovedp
YCombinator
Built With
- java
- javascript
- nextjs
- postgresql
- springboot
- supabase
- typescript
Log in or sign up for Devpost to join the conversation.